Egmont Koblinger wrote:

Hi,

In 8-bit mode (e.g. LC_ALL=hu_HU) accented letters are treated as parts of
words. However, in UTF-8 mode (e.g. LC_ALL=hu_HU.UTF-8) these letters are
treated as word separators. This influences at least the following cases:

The backward-word and forward-word code in readline-5.0 was not
converted to understand multibyte characters and non-ascii word
separators at all.  This will be fixed in the next version.
